Phaser 7400 The Xerox Phaser® 7400 printer is an affordable, high-performance A3 colour printer that meets the needs of businesses on deadlines. The printer’s versatility, power and speed are ready for whatever job you send it. Quick Facts
  • Colour: up to 36 ppm
  • Black: up to 40 ppm
  • First-page-out time as fast as 12 seconds
  • 800 MHz PowerPC processor
  • Maximum paper size: 320mm x 450mm
  • All models come standard with 10/100Base-TX Ethernet connectivity
  • Standard paper input capacity: 800 sheets
  • Maximum paper input capacity: 3,000 sheets
  • Finisher/stacker/stapler/hole puncher capable of handling up to 1,000 sheets
  • Maximum duty cycle up to 150,000 pages per month
  • What comes in the box
  • Colour toner cartridges (capacity: 9,000 pages each1) Black toner cartridge (capacity: 15,000 pages1) Imaging units (capacity: 30,000 pages per colour2) Waste cartridge (capacity: 30,000 pages2) Fuser (capacity: 100,000 pages2) Transfer unit (capacity: 100,000 pages2) Finisher ships with 5,000 staples Power cord Software and documentation
Features that Reduce Costs
  • Fast automatic two-sided printing reduces paper waste and creates professional-looking documents
  • Print in-house instead of sending jobs out to commercial printers or quick copy shops -- saving time and money
  • Low acquisition cost compared to many colour tabloid devices saves you money right from the start
  • Low cost per print in black-and-white and colour save you money every time you print
  • High print cartridge capacity saves money and reduces overall downtime
  • Usage Analysis Tool and job accounting allows administrators to easily collect, organize and analyze print job data to calculate charge-back billings and control costs
Features that Save Time
  • Fast print speed means you don't have to wait, even for long or complex print jobs
  • First-page-out time of as fast as 12 seconds means documents will be ready when you need them
  • Enhanced PrintingScout monitors all print jobs, and uses pop-up windows to inform users right away of any trouble and how to fix it
  • Pages remaining on supplies helps you determine when to re-order supplies, so you will always have enough on hand
  • Run black allows the printer to keep printing even when a colour runs out
  • Support Centre provides easy access to all user documentation, tools and utilities electronically instead of searching for a CD-ROM
  • High paper input capacities between 800 and 3,000 sheets enable longer print runs and fewer interventions
  • Intelligent Ready feature learns when users start and stop printing for the day and warms-up or returns to power save mode accordingly
Features that Enhance Productivity
  • 1,000-sheet Finisher can staple, hole punch (3- or 4-hole options), V-fold booklets, and saddle stitch to create professional documents ready for distribution - no need for off-line finishing or sending jobs offsite
  • Smart Tray Selection allows you to confirm that the correct paper is loaded in the printer before sending the job
  • Personal Print feature stores processed print jobs in a private folder on the printer so you can quickly print them on-demand via the control panel or the web
  • Booklet printing automatically arranges your document so you can easily create 216mm x 279mm booklet. . . ready for you to fold and staple (requires duplex unit)
  • Easily manage, configure, and troubleshoot the Phaser 7400 from any computer with CentreWare® Internet Services network web administration tools
  • RAM collation allows you to print multiple copies of multi-page documents in the correct numerical sequence using RAM memory instead of a hard drive
  • Print banners up to 320mm x 1219mm and create eye-catching signs in-house for less time, money, and hassle
  • Automatic page size substitution will select the closest page size you have loaded in the printer, such as print an A4-size file on letter-size paper
  • Email alerts allow key personnel to stay on top of printing issues by automatically receiving an email when the device needs supplies or maintenance
  • Configuration card is a postage stamp-sized chip located on the side of the printer that captures the printer's feature set and network settings to enable a fast and easy upgrade and help shorten service calls
1 Average standard pages. Declared Yield based on 5% area coverage on A4/letter size page. Yield will vary based on image, area coverage and print mode. 2 Approximate pages. Declared Yield on Drums based on an average job size of 3 pages A4/letter size. Declared Yield on Fusers based on A4/letter size 20 lb (75 gsm) pages. Drum and Fuser Yields will vary based on job run length, media type, size, weight, orientation, and usage patterns.
